Manufacturing Engineer – 12-month Fixed Term Contract
This role will drive continuous improvement and sustainable manufacturing practices within a leading organisation specialising in cutting-edge technology. The organisation is based in a state-of-the-art facility where you can witness products go from concept to delivery.

 You will be key in driving continuous improvement in a lean manufacturing environment. They manufacture cutting-edge technology that is revolutionising the industry, and this role will significantly impact the business.

This role is a 50/50 split between working inside and outside a cleanroom.

What You’ll Do:
  • Support manufacturing operations with engineering expertise
  • Lead process improvement initiatives to enhance quality, efficiency, and cost-effectiveness
  • Develop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and implement lean manufacturing techniques
  • Work closely with NPI teams to ensure seamless product introductions
  • Use Six Sigma methodologies and structured problem-solving tools
What We’re Looking For:
  • At least 3 years’ experience in manufacturing engineering
  • Strong knowledge of lean principles and Six Sigma
  • Ability to analyse manufacturing data and optimize production processes
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ills
